WebWhen it comes to choosing desserts remember to aim for potassium less than 200 mg per serving. Examples of low potassium desserts include sugar cookies, graham crackers, cheesecake, angel food, spice, or lemon cake. High potassium desserts include dark chocolate and some fruit desserts, like sweet potato pie. WebNov 22, 2024 · Almost all foods have some potassium. A food that is considered “high-potassium” generally has 200 mg or more potassium per serving. WebHigh potassium foods to limit: Limit milk to ½ pint per day (300ml). Limit yoghurt to 3 small pots per week. Condensed milk, evaporated milk and milk powders. Lower potassium choices: Cheese, crème fraiche or cream. Rice or oat milk. Food group: Salt substitutes. High potassium foods to limit: Lo-Salt, So-Low, reduced sodium salt.
